How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Greater Newark?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Greater Newark Studio Apartments | $2,050 | $900 | $3,587 |
| Greater Newark 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,372 | $800 | $6,739 |
| Greater Newark 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,849 | $1,050 | $8,770 |
| Greater Newark 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,544 | $1,559 | $6,542 |
| Greater Newark 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,907 | $1,950 | $5,500 |
| Greater Newark 5 Bedroom Apartments | $3,290 | $2,500 | $4,000 |
| Greater Newark 6 Bedroom Apartments | $3,300 | $3,300 | $3,300 |
